If you're driven by curiosity and want your work to influence the future of location analytics, join us and help make data work smarter. About the Role: Senior Database Administrator (DBA)/Data Ops Engineer You will be responsible for the management, optimisation, and reliability of our databases and data pipelines. Working closely with our team, you … for candidates who thrive in a data-driven, collaborative environment and want to make a tangible impact on business outcomes. Key Responsibilities: Manage, maintain, and optimise cloud databases Monitor database performance, troubleshoot issues, and implement improvements Design, build, and maintain robust data pipelines for ingestion, transformation, and delivery of large datasets Improve and implement processes for loading, validating, and … managing data sets Ensure data security, integrity, and compliance with relevant standards Automate routine database and data pipeline tasks to improve efficiency Support the development and deployment of new data-driven products and features Collaborate with cross-functional teams to deliver high-quality data solutions Essentials About You Must have: at least 7 years' experience as a Data Ops More ❯
Farnborough, Hampshire, England, United Kingdom Hybrid / WFH Options
Eutopia Solutions ltd
Data Engineer to join their growing data team. This is a fantastic opportunity to work with cutting-edge technologies and play a key role in the design, development, and optimisation of scalable data solutions. The Role As a Python Data Engineer, you will be instrumental in building robust data pipelines and maintaining cloud-based databases to support a range … Experience Proven experience as a Python Developer or Data Engineer Strong SQL Server knowledge and experience working with large datasets Hands-on experience with Microsoft Azure and Azure SQL Database Proficiency with Docker and containerisation tools Experience working with APIs for data extraction Desirable Skills Familiarity with big data technologies such as Spark and Kafka Experience with machine learning … frameworks like TensorFlow or PyTorch Knowledge of data visualisation tools such as Power BI or Tableau Strong understanding of data modelling and databaseoptimisation Experience with dimensional data modelling Interested in learning more? Apply now to find out how you can join an innovative team and help shape data infrastructure for a forward-thinking organisation. More ❯
Gloucester, Gloucestershire, United Kingdom Hybrid / WFH Options
Navtech, Inc
a reliable, optimum, and customized user experience to more than 500 customers worldwide. We are looking for a seasoned Software Engineer with extensive experience in designing, implementing, and optimizing database solutions in a microservices-based environment. As a member of our team, you will contribute to the full lifecycle of our data persistence layer, from schema design and performance … tuning to ensuring robust replication, disaster recovery, and seamless integration within our cloud-native microservice ecosystem. Responsibilities: Design & Develop Database Solutions: Architect, design, and implement highly optimized relational (e.g., MySQL, PostgreSQL, AWS Aurora, SQL Server) and NoSQL (e.g., MongoDB, DynamoDB, Redis) database schemas, ensuring data integrity, performance, and scalability for microservices. Performance Optimization & Tuning: Proactively analyze and optimize … complex queries, implement efficient indexing strategies, and manage partitioning/sharding to ensure peak database performance and handle high throughput. Reliability & Disaster Recovery: Design, implement, and maintain robust backup, disaster recovery, and high-availability solutions, including replication (master-slave/multi-master) and failover configurations, to ensure data durability and system uptime. Cloud Database Management: Deploy, configure, and More ❯
Cardiff, South Glamorgan, United Kingdom Hybrid / WFH Options
Navtech, Inc
a reliable, optimum, and customized user experience to more than 500 customers worldwide. We are looking for a seasoned Software Engineer with extensive experience in designing, implementing, and optimizing database solutions in a microservices-based environment. As a member of our team, you will contribute to the full lifecycle of our data persistence layer, from schema design and performance … tuning to ensuring robust replication, disaster recovery, and seamless integration within our cloud-native microservice ecosystem. Responsibilities: Design & Develop Database Solutions: Architect, design, and implement highly optimized relational (e.g., MySQL, PostgreSQL, AWS Aurora, SQL Server) and NoSQL (e.g., MongoDB, DynamoDB, Redis) database schemas, ensuring data integrity, performance, and scalability for microservices. Performance Optimization & Tuning: Proactively analyze and optimize … complex queries, implement efficient indexing strategies, and manage partitioning/sharding to ensure peak database performance and handle high throughput. Reliability & Disaster Recovery: Design, implement, and maintain robust backup, disaster recovery, and high-availability solutions, including replication (master-slave/multi-master) and failover configurations, to ensure data durability and system uptime. Cloud Database Management: Deploy, configure, and More ❯
Birmingham, West Midlands, United Kingdom Hybrid / WFH Options
Amtis Professional Ltd
Factory, Blob Storage Python/PySpark SQL Server, Parquet, Delta Lake Deep understanding of: ETL/ELT, CDC, stream processing Lakehouse architecture and data warehousing Scalable pipeline design and databaseoptimisation A proactive mindset, strong problem-solving skills, and clear communication If you're an experienced data engineer and interested in the opportunity, please apply with an updated More ❯
Chester, Cheshire, North West, United Kingdom Hybrid / WFH Options
Marstep Resourcing Solutions
services (ECS/EKS, RDS, S3, etc.). Experience with API design, distributed systems, and high-availability architectures. Familiarity with CI/CD tools and DevOps practices. Proficient in database administration for MySQL and Redis . Desirable Familiarity with Infrastructure-as-Code (e.g., Terraform, Kubectl). Experience with scaling infrastructure for high-availability systems or large databases. Knowledge of … ecosystem knowledge Experience with AWS services (especially RDS, S3, EKS, EC2, ALB) in production. High-availability and distributed systems ideally understand designing for scale, including load balancing, caching (Redis), databaseoptimisation (MySQL), and resilience in distributed environments. Minimum 2 years of professional Laravel experience + Minimum 5 years of PHP experience Will have worked on production Laravel applications More ❯
Shoreham-By-Sea, England, United Kingdom Hybrid / WFH Options
Tenth Revolution Group
Hybrid, UK Salary: Up to £68,000 per annum Contract: Permanent, Full-time A leading UK organisation is seeking an experienced Senior Business Analyst with a strong background in database design, data modelling, and systems impact assessment. This is a unique opportunity to work at the intersection of strategic data architecture and operational analytics support, influencing enterprise-wide data … Act as the bridge between technical teams and business stakeholders. Essential Skills & Experience: Strong Business Analysis experience, with a focus on databases and data systems. Expert knowledge of relational database design, normalisation, and data modelling. Proficiency in SQL, databaseoptimisation, and data mapping. Strong understanding of ETL processes, data warehousing concepts (Snowflake advantageous), and API integrations. Experience More ❯
Reigate, Surrey, South East, United Kingdom Hybrid / WFH Options
Anonymous Recruiter
experience in web development, specifically working with high-traffic Laravel applications Strong knowledge of: PHP, Laravel, MySQL JavaScript, HTML5, CSS3 Laravel Livewire Tailwind CSS FilamentPHP Experience in API integrations, databaseoptimisation, and server-side security Comfortable with Git version control and agile development practices Ability to work independently and as part of a remote team Good communication and More ❯
for in you 3+ years of experience developing backend systems in a production environment 4+ years' experience with Python and Django Strong knowledge of SQL databases and experience optimising database performance Experience with CI/CD, testing frameworks (Jest, React Testing Library), or design Understanding of software design principles and experience building REST APIs Proficiency in Git and version More ❯
Conduct in-depth reviews of codebases to identify issues, inefficiencies, and potential security vulnerabilities. Provide recommendations on best practices, including coding standards, design patterns, and maintainability improvements. Support performance optimisation through refactoring and improved architecture. Support testing and QA process. 2. Cloud Infrastructure Support & Design Assist in designing, implementing, and optimising cloud infrastructure (predominantly Azure) Provide guidance on cloud … provide remediation strategies. Ensure compliance with industry standards (ISO 27001, GDPR, SOC 2, etc.). Implement best practices for secure software development (OWASP, encryption, IAM, etc.). 6. Performance Optimisation & Scaling Analyse system bottlenecks and recommend performance tuning strategies. Support database optimisations, caching mechanisms, and load balancing strategies. Assist in designing auto-scaling solutions to handle peak loads … Assist in improving monitoring, logging, and alerting solutions. 8. Technology & Tooling Selection Assess and recommend programming languages, frameworks, and development tools based on business needs. Guide the selection of database technologies (SQL, NoSQL, time-series databases, etc.). Help teams adopt emerging technologies such as AI/ML when relevant. 9. Stakeholder Communication & Knowledge Transfer Provide technical workshops and More ❯
Manchester, Lancashire, England, United Kingdom Hybrid / WFH Options
Oscar Technology
a BI Developer to join their team on a permanent basis. Your work would involve ETL processes for data integration, working with stakeholders to understand business needs, and optimizing database queries. The role is offered on an almost remote basis, with one visit per month to their Manchester office. This is a great opportunity to add real value to … and data modelling techniques. Implement and optimise Extract, Transform, Load (ETL) processes for integrating data from various sources into the data warehouse. Monitor system performance, identify bottlenecks, and optimise database queries for improved system efficiency. Collaborate with stakeholders, gather requirements, and provide technical guidance to ensure the BI system meets the organisation's needs. Mentor and provide leadership to More ❯
Birmingham, West Midlands, England, United Kingdom Hybrid / WFH Options
Robert Walters
robust data environments, particularly within Snowflake, and enjoys the challenge of managing data flows across multiple systems. Data & Systems Lead - What will you be doing? * Overseeing the maintenance and optimisation of the Snowflake environment, ensuring seamless operation across all business units.* Responding promptly to ad hoc requests for ETL, delivering accurate datasets as required by stakeholders.* Collaborating closely with … platforms like Dynamics. Data & Systems Lead - What will you need? * Experience managing Snowflake environments.* Proficiency in designing and executing ETL processes.* Strong SQL skills for writing complex queries, optimising database performance, and troubleshooting issues as they arise.* Excellent communication abilities are vital for translating technical concepts into clear recommendations for colleagues at all levels.* Familiarity with integrating data from More ❯
Manchester, Lancashire, United Kingdom Hybrid / WFH Options
Behavioural Insights Team
Stack Developer at BIT? Production Full-Stack Development: Experience building, deploying, and maintaining full-stack web applications in production environments. You're comfortable with the entire technology stack from database design through to front-end implementation. Prototyping and product development. You have experience of rapidly developing and releasing (e.g. in a matter of days/weeks) early stage digital … are new to you in order to learn, deliver value and continually improve/iterate. Scalable System Design: Proven experience designing and implementing systems that handle significant scale, including database optimization, caching strategies, load balancing, and performance monitoring. You understand the technical challenges of serving thousands of concurrent users. Service support. You can identify, locate and fix faults. And More ❯